Kering FP&A Intern
Kering, a global luxury group, is renowned for nurturing a portfolio of iconic fashion, leather goods, and jewelry houses, including Gucci, Saint Laurent, Bottega Veneta, and Balenciaga, among others. As a leader in the luxury industry, Kering empowers its brands to push the boundaries of creative expression while fostering sustainable and responsible luxury. With a workforce of 47,000 employees and a revenue of €17.2 billion in 2024, Kering is committed to innovation and excellence.
- Assist in the monthly financial closing process, ensuring the accuracy of accounting data.
- Collaborate closely with the accounting team to ensure the accuracy of provisions and recharges from Kering to its brands, utilizing Power BI and contributing to database construction.
- Produce monthly financial reports for the Group's financial management.
- Analyze monthly closures, including costs and capex, comparing results with budgets and previous year's performance.
- Contribute to the preparation of budgets and forecasts for France and the consolidation of global data, in collaboration with international FP&A counterparts.
- Prepare books and dashboards for budget presentations.
